Episcopal Church Faces Backlash Over Stance on White South African Refugee Resettlement
The Episcopal Church is embroiled in controversy following its recent statement on the resettlement of white South African refugees. The church's perceived reluctance to fully embrace these refugees has sparked outrage among various groups, igniting a fierce debate about immigration policy, racial justice, and the role of religious institutions in humanitarian crises.
The initial statement, released last week, emphasized the church's commitment to assisting all refugees in need. However, critics argue the statement lacked the same forceful advocacy seen in the church’s previous support for other refugee populations. This perceived disparity has led to accusations of bias and a questioning of the church's dedication to its own stated principles of equality and compassion.
The Heart of the Controversy: Selective Compassion?
The central criticism revolves around what many perceive as a selective approach to refugee resettlement. While the Episcopal Church has a long history of supporting refugee resettlement programs globally, its response to the plight of white South African refugees has been deemed insufficient by many. This perceived disparity, critics argue, stems from a complex interplay of factors including:
- Historical Context: South Africa's history of apartheid casts a long shadow, making discussions surrounding race and inequality particularly sensitive. Some argue the church’s perceived hesitancy is a reflection of this complex legacy.
- Resource Allocation: Concerns have been raised about the allocation of resources. Critics question whether the church is adequately prioritizing aid to white South African refugees compared to other refugee groups.
- Public Perception: The church’s response has been met with public scrutiny, with many accusing the institution of failing to live up to its stated values. Social media has been a key battleground, with strong opinions expressed on both sides of the debate.
Episcopal Church Responds: Clarification or Damage Control?
In response to the growing criticism, the Episcopal Church issued a follow-up statement attempting to clarify its position. This statement reiterated its commitment to supporting all refugees, irrespective of race or background. However, the damage may already be done, with many remaining unconvinced by the church’s efforts. The church’s leadership now faces the challenge of regaining public trust and demonstrating its commitment to inclusive and equitable resettlement programs.
